Ganduje Mourns Tragic Death of 22 Kano Athletes in Road Accident

Former Kano State Governor and National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Dr. Abdullahi Umar Ganduje, has expressed deep sorrow over the tragic death of 22 members of the Kano State sports contingent returning from the National Sports Festival held in Abeokuta, Ogun State.
The athletes lost their lives when the vehicle transporting them veered off the road and plunged into a bridge at Dakatsalle, near Kura Local Government Area in Kano State.
In a statement released by his Chief Press Secretary, Edwin Olofu, Ganduje described the incident as an immense tragedy—not just for the grieving families and the people of Kano, but for the entire nation.
“This is a deeply sorrowful moment,” Ganduje said. “These young athletes set out in the spirit of unity, patriotism, and excellence to represent both our state and the nation. Losing them in such a devastating and untimely accident is a monumental national loss.”
Ganduje praised the fallen athletes as dedicated, talented youths who represented the bright future of Nigerian sports and the pride of Kano State.
He extended heartfelt condolences to the bereaved families, the government of Kano State, and the broader Nigerian sports community, offering prayers for the souls of the departed and for comfort to those mourning their loss.
Ganduje also called for a full investigation into the circumstances of the crash, urging authorities to strengthen safety measures for future national sporting events to safeguard the lives of young Nigerian athletes.
“May Almighty Allah (SWT) grant eternal rest to the departed and give their families the fortitude to bear this painful and irreparable loss,” he concluded.
